CVE-2009-1574
Published: May 6, 2009
Modified: Aug 7, 2024
PUBLISHED
Description
racoon/isakmp_frag.c in ipsec-tools before 0.7.2 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(crash) via crafted fragmented packets without a payload, which triggers a NULL pointer dereference.
